Something is definitely dodgy with EA systems. Within the last couple of months I've received several emails stating that someone has logged in to my account, from various places around the world. Each time, I log in to my account on EA (by going to EA site myself, not doing anything with the email apart from deleting it), change my password to a 16 character random string of letters (caps and no caps), numbers and symbols yet, somehow, someone is managing to gain access to my account, repeatedly.
I'm am as close to certain as I can be that my other online accounts are secure (e.g. email) and I'm not recieving any attempted password resets or anything, so it seems like someone is just getting my password from somewhere and just using that to log in.
Can anyone shine any light on this?
